Tesla K20c vs Tesla K40c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

Tesla K20c
The Tesla K20c is manufactured by NVIDIA. It was released in November 12 2012. It features the Kepler architecture. The core clock speed is 706 MHz. It has 2496 shading units. The thermal design power (TDP) is 225W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 4,432 points. Launch price was $3,199.

Tesla K40c
The Tesla K40c is manufactured by NVIDIA. It was released in October 8 2013. It features the Kepler architecture. The core clock ranges from 745 MHz to 876 MHz. It has 2880 shading units. The thermal design power (TDP) is 245W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 4,495 points. Launch price was $7,699.
Graphics Performance
The Tesla K20c scores 4,432 and the Tesla K40c reaches 4,495 in the G3D Mark benchmark — just a 1.4% difference, making them near-identical in rasterization performance. The Tesla K20c is built on Kepler while the Tesla K40c uses Kepler, both on a 28 nm process. Shader units: 2,496 (Tesla K20c) vs 2,880 (Tesla K40c). Raw compute: 3.524 TFLOPS (Tesla K20c) vs 5.046 TFLOPS (Tesla K40c).

Power & Dimensions
The Tesla K20c draws 225W versus the Tesla K40c's 245W — a 8.5% difference. The Tesla K20c is more power-efficient. Recommended PSU: 350W (Tesla K20c) vs 350W (Tesla K40c). Power connectors: PCIe-powered vs PCIe-powered. Card length: 267mm vs 267mm, occupying 2 vs 2 slots.
